TriLink® 7-Deaza-2'-deoxyguanosine-5'-Triphosphate
Supplier: TriLink BioTechnologies
This deoxyguanosine analog lacks the N7 nitrogen found in the natural guanine nucleobase. Replacement of this nitrogen atom with a carbon atom results in diminished structure of the major groove in DNA and may disrupt base stacking, but does not interfere with Watson-Crick base pairing. This is desirable for applications such as amplification and sequencing of GC-rich nucleic acid sequences.

TriLink® CleanCap® M6 EPO mRNA (N1MePsU)
Supplier: TriLink BioTechnologies
EPO mRNA encodes the human erythropoietin (EPO) protein, a hormone that controls erythropoiesis, or red blood cell production. EPO also plays a role in wound healing and the brain’s response to neural injury. Kariko et al. showed that transfection of EPO mRNA in vivo resulted in significant increases of both reticulocyte counts and hematocrits.

TriLink® 2',3'-Dideoxyguanosine-5'-O-(1-Thiotriphosphate)
Supplier: TriLink BioTechnologies
2',3'-Dideoxyguanosine-5'-O-(1-Thiotriphosphate) is a sugar modified nucleoside triphosphate where the 2' and 3' hydroxyl groups are absent, resulting in chain termination. This ddGTP analog also contains a 1-Thiotriphosphate which results in a nuclease resistant phosphorothioate linkage. The inability of polymerases to extend from a dideoxy nucleotide causes chain termination and is useful in antiviral research and in a variety of biotechnology applications.

TriLink® N6-Methyladenosine-5'-Triphosphate
Supplier: TriLink BioTechnologies
N6-methyl adenosine (N6-methyl ATP) is a base modified analog of adenosine and is found as a minor nucleoside in natural RNAs (Meyer et al.). N6-methyl ATP can substitute for ATP in some biological systems, and is a potent agonist for P2Y-purinoceptors in the guinea pig, taenia coli (Burnstock et al.).

TriLink® Biotin-16-Aminoallyl-2'-deoxyuridine-5'-Triphosphate
Supplier: TriLink BioTechnologies
Biotin-16-Aminoallyl-2'-deoxyuridine can be enzymatically incorporated into DNA via PCR, nick translation, primer extension using Klenow(exo-) DNA polymerase, and terminal deoxynucleotidyl transferase (TdT). Biotinylated cDNA can be prepared with this NTP using Moloney Murine Leukemia Virus (M-MLV) reverse transcriptase.
